A Playground That Welcomes Everyone

The Riverfront Park Braille Trail and Sensory Garden is more than just a play area—it’s an experience crafted to be inclusive and interactive. With a unique Braille trail, kids with visual impairments can explore their surroundings through touch, while sighted children gain a new appreciation for sensory learning. The sensory garden adds another layer of discovery, filled with textures, scents, and colors that spark curiosity and creativity.

Unique Features That Stand Out

What sets this playground apart are its thoughtful touches designed for accessibility and engagement:

• Braille Trail: An interactive path that encourages exploration through touch and sound, perfect for tactile learners.

• Sensory Garden: A vibrant space with plants and flowers selected for their textures and fragrances, stimulating young minds.

• Outdoor Xylophones: Musical play structures that let kids create their own tunes while enjoying the fresh air.

• Walking Trails: Scenic paths for families to stroll while taking in the natural beauty of Watertown.

• Picnic Areas: Shaded spots to relax and enjoy a snack or packed lunch.

These features make the park ideal for children who thrive with hands-on learning and for families looking for inclusive activities.
